MIRZOYAN, Levon was born in November 1897 in village Ashan, Shusha Uyezd, Azerbaydzhan
1912, while at school, joined Social-Democratic movement. 1917-1920 trade-union work. Secretary, Binagada Branch of Boilermakers and Riveters Union (then Metalworkers Union).
Member, Bolshevik military squad. Deputy, Baku Soviet of Workers and Soldiers’ Deputy. July 1917 after collapse of Soviet regime in Baku, carried out underground Party work.
Resumed trade-union work after establishment of Soviet regime in Azerbaydzhan August 1920 elected chairman, Azer Trade-Union Council. 1921 head, Baku Committee, Communist Party Azerbaydzhan
Then worked for Central Committee, Communist Party Azerbaydzhan From late 1925 secretary, Central Committee, Communist Party Azerbaydzhan From October 1929 secretary, Permanent’ Okrug Party Committee.
Then second secretary, Ural Oblast All-Union Communist Party (Bolsheviks) Committee. 1933 elected first secretary, Kaz Kray Party Committee. June 1937, with formation of Communist Party Kaz, first secretary, Central Committee, Communist Party (Bolsheviks) Kazakhstan
At 15th and 16th Party Congresses elected candidate member, at 17th Congress member, Central Committee, All-Union Communist Party (Bolsheviks). Member, Union of the Soviet Socialist Republics Central Executive Committee of several convocations. 1938 arrested by State Security organs.
